    Charming and Community-Centered Living in Frankfort, Kansas

    Welcoming you with open arms, Frankfort, Kansas, is a delightful blend of small-town warmth and community spirit, where history and modernity coalesce into a truly unique living experience. Situated in the picturesque northeast part of the state, this friendly town offers an inviting atmosphere that exudes comfort and charm. Frankfort is a place where neighbors become friends and the sense of community thrives in every corner. The annual festivals and local events, like the beloved Frankfort Summer Fest, bring residents together in celebration, while also offering a chance to showcase the town’s vibrant culture and traditions. The local cafes, delightful shops, and family-owned eateries infuse life into Main Street, echoing nostalgia while catering to modern tastes. Education and family values play a pivotal role here, with the local schools known for their dedication and nurturing environment. Frankfort isn't just a place to live—it’s a place to grow. Outdoor enthusiasts will find solace in the scenic parks and recreational spaces, perfect for leisurely walks, picnics, and sports activities. The serene landscapes surrounding Frankfort offer peace of mind and a place to appreciate the beauty of nature in its simplest form. Living in Frankfort, Kansas, is not just about finding a home, but about finding belonging. This heartwarming community, filled with promise and friendliness, makes it easy to see why so many choose to call Frankfort their own personal haven.

    Industrial and Workforce Development

    in Frankfort

    Frankfort, located in the heart of Marshall County, Kansas, offers a strategic rural setting for industrial and manufacturing growth. Its position along key regional highways, including US-77 and KS-9, provides direct access to major Midwest markets and transportation corridors. The city benefits from proximity to Union Pacific rail lines, supporting logistics and distribution needs for local businesses. Industrial real estate in Frankfort is supported by available land and affordable property costs, making it attractive for companies seeking expansion or new development. The region has seen steady interest from agribusiness, light manufacturing, and logistics firms, thanks in part to its supportive local government and the presence of shovel-ready sites in and near the Frankfort Industrial Park. Frankfort’s workforce is bolstered by partnerships with area technical colleges and workforce development programs coordinated through the Kansas Department of Commerce. These initiatives help ensure a pipeline of skilled labor for advanced manufacturing, warehousing, and related sectors. Local officials work closely with businesses to facilitate permitting, site selection, and access to state and county incentive programs, including tax abatements and infrastructure grants designed to lower the cost of entry for new industrial projects.

    Quality of Life & Other Advantages

    • Frankfort offers a low cost of living, safe neighborhoods, and a welcoming small-town atmosphere ideal for families and workforce stability.
    • Access to quality public schools, healthcare facilities, and regional technical colleges supports both employee retention and community growth.
    • Outdoor recreation, community events, and proximity to larger regional centers provide a balanced lifestyle and additional amenities for residents and businesses alike.
